The opening of a direct air corridor between Iran and Houthi-controlled Sanaa marks a significant escalation in the Yemen conflict. It bypasses maritime blockades and could accelerate the flow of personnel and materiel to the Houthis, potentially destabilizing the regional balance of power. The arrival of a Mahan Air flight, ostensibly for medical evacuations, raises questions about the true nature of this new logistical link. The next development to watch is whether this route becomes regularized and how Saudi Arabia and its allies respond.
